A High-Voltage Capacitor Bank Design with a Built-in Spark Gap Switch

Abstract

A 20-kV, 38-kJ capacitor bank with a built-in spark gap switch was designed, built, and tested. Currents in excess of 400 kA were achieved. The motivation for the design, the details of the design, and the results of testing are described.
